Understanding the Connection Between Vitamins and Hair Health

Vitamin deficiency can significantly impact the health of your hair, leading to issues such as thinning, brittleness, and loss. Essential vitamins, along with a balanced diet, play a crucial role in maintaining the strength and vitality of hair follicles. Without adequate nutritional support, the hair growth cycle can become disrupted.

Understanding the specific vitamins that contribute to hair health is important. Vitamins such as biotin, vitamin D, and vitamin E are renowned for their roles in promoting healthy hair growth. Ensuring these nutrients are part of your regular diet can help mitigate hair-related issues caused by deficiencies.

The Influence of Hormones on Hair Growth

Hormones also have a profound effect on hair health, affecting both growth patterns and follicle integrity. Conditions such as hormonal imbalances can lead to hair thinning and loss, which is a concern for many, particularly women. By regulating hormone levels, you can significantly improve hair vitality and growth.

Regulating these hormonal levels often involves lifestyle changes and, in some cases, medical interventions. For example, addressing thyroid imbalances or managing conditions like PCOS can have a noticeable impact on your hair health. Incorporating the right dietary components is a key part of this approach.

The Role of Probiotics in Hair and Overall Health

Probiotics are not just beneficial for gut health; they also play a pivotal role in maintaining overall health, which indirectly influences hair health. A balanced gut microbiome can enhance nutrient absorption, ensuring that your body gets the essential vitamins and minerals required for healthy hair.

Several studies suggest that probiotics can help mitigate issues like scalp inflammation and dandruff, which can impair hair growth. By supporting your gut health, you can promote a healthier scalp and more robust hair follicles.

Integrating Vitamins into Your Daily Routine

Incorporating vitamins into your daily routine can be simple and effective. Start by consuming a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and proteins. Additionally, consider taking supplements to fill any nutritional gaps. Consult with a healthcare provider to determine the correct dosage tailored to your health needs.

Supplements like biotin, folic acid, and omega-3 fatty acids are known to benefit hair health. When combined with a healthy lifestyle, these supplements can make a significant difference in the quality of your hair, promoting shine, strength, and growth.

Using Hormonal Balance to Support Hair Health

Achieving hormonal balance is crucial for maintaining healthy hair. This involves a holistic approach that includes proper diet, stress management, and sometimes medical interventions to address specific issues like thyroid problems or menopause.

Techniques such as mindfulness, yoga, and stress-reduction exercises can also help in balancing hormones naturally. Combining these methods with the right supplements ensures your hair receives the nourishment it needs.

FAQ

What vitamins are most important for hair health?

Biotin, vitamin D, and vitamin E are essential for hair health due to their roles in promoting hair growth and maintaining follicle strength. Ensuring these vitamins are part of your diet can prevent common hair issues associated with nutritional deficiencies.

How do probiotics benefit hair growth?

Probiotics support gut health, which is crucial for efficient nutrient absorption. A healthy gut can ensure your body receives the necessary vitamins for strong hair growth, while also addressing issues like inflammation that can hinder hair health.

Can hormonal imbalance affect my hair?

Yes, hormonal imbalances can lead to hair thinning and loss. Regulating hormone levels through diet, lifestyle changes, and medical interventions can improve hair growth and prevent further loss.

What lifestyle changes support better hair health?

Incorporating a balanced diet, regular exercise, and stress-reducing practices like yoga and meditation can enhance hair health. These changes promote hormone balance and ensure your body and hair get the nourishment they need.
